The weight of water is 62 and one half lb per cubic foot. How many cubic feet would be occupied by 180 lb of​ water?
inessss [21]

<u>Answer:</u>

2\frac{22}{25} cubic feet

<u>Step-by-step explanation:</u>

We are given that the weight of water is 62 and one half lb per cubic foot and we are to find the number of cubic feet that would be occupied by 180 lb of water.

For that, we will divide total amount of water by per unit weight of water:

Cubic feet occupied by 180 lb of water = \frac{180}{62.5} = = 2.88 cubic feet or 2\frac{22}{25} cubic feet
